Abstract

APARATO DE ILUMINACIÓN LED CON (A CAPACIDAD PARA AJUSTAR (A DISTRIBUCIÓN DE LUZ, QUE COMPRENDE: UN PANEL DE SOPORTE QUE TIENE UNA PLURALIDAD DE ALETAS DE DISIPACIÓN DE CALOR EN UNA SUPERFICIE POSTERIOR DEL MISMO Y PROPORCIONA UNA SUPERFICIE DE SOPORTE: UN SUBSTRATO ACOPLADO A LA SUPERFICIE DE SOPORTE DEL PANET DE SOPORTE, UNA PLURALIDAD DE LEDS ESTÁ MONTADA AT SUBSTRATO; Y UNA SUPERFICIE DE REFLEXIÓN UBICADA SOBRE UNA SUPERFICIE FRONTAL DEL SUBSTRATO QUE TORMO UN PATRÓN DE DISTRIBUCIÓN DE LUZ SOBRE EL SUELO REFLEJANDO (A LUZ EMITIDA DESDE LA PLURALIDAD DE LEDS; EN DONDE LAS ALETAS CTE DISIPACIÓN DE CALOR Y EL PANEL DE SOPORTE QUE PROPORCIONA (A SUPERFICIE DE SOPORTE SE PROPORCIONAN INTOGRATMENTE, Y LA SUPERFICIE DE REFLEXIÓN SE PROPORCIONA EN UNA SUPERFICIE INTERIOR DE UNA PORCIÓN DEL PATRÓN DE DISTRIBUCIÓN CTE LUZ PROPORCIONADA PARA QUE SE PUEDA SEPARAR DE LA SUPERFICIE DE SOPORTE: EN DONDE UN AGUJERO DE ACOPLAMIEN(O QUE TIENE UN SOPORTE INSERTADO Y FIJO AL AGUJERO DE ACOPLAMIENTO SE PROPORCIONA EN UN LADO POSTERIOR DE UNA PORCIÓN DE DISIPACIÓN DE CALOR QUE COMPRENDE LAS ATETAS DE DISIPACIÓN DE CALOR; EN DONDE TAS ATETAS DE DISIPACIÓN DE CALOR ESTÁN DISPUESTAS PERPENDICULARES AL SUELO; Y EN DONDE UN ANCHO DE UN LADO CENTRAT DE CADA UNA DE TAS ALETAS DE DISIPACIÓN DE CALOR ES MÁS ANCHO QUE UN ANCHO DE LOS EXTREMOS SUPEROR E INFERIOR DE CADA UNA DE LAS ALETAS DE DISIPACIÓN DE CALOR.
